How they compare

Eswatini currently reports 2.15 million against 1.70 million in Central African Republic, a difference of 447,250.

That makes Eswatini's figure about 1.3 times Central African Republic's.

The two have swapped places 6 times across 22 shared years of data; in 2001 it was Eswatini ahead.

Central African Republic ranks 131st and Eswatini ranks 129th of 168 countries.

Eswatini has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Central African Republic Eswatini Difference Ahead
2000s 1.93 million 20.23 million 18.31 million Eswatini
2010s 7.63 million 9.38 million 1.75 million Eswatini
2020s 2.98 million 3.46 million 482,467 Eswatini

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
